Shrub pruning is a important practice for keeping healthy, appealing shrubs while managing their shapes and size. Pruning gets rid of dead, damaged, or diseased branches, encourages brand-new growth, and promotes flowering or fruiting. Each shrub types may have specific pruning requirements, including timing, cut positioning, and method. The procedure includes examining the plant's structure, selectively trimming branches, and thinning thick locations to enhance air flow and light penetration. Seasonal factors to consider make sure that pruning does not interfere with blooming cycles or tension the plant throughout crucial development durations. Constant shrub pruning improves both visual appeal and plant health. Proper care allows shrubs to preserve a well balanced type, prosper in the landscape, and contribute favorably to the overall style of the outdoor area
